Abstract The purpose of this study was to identify patterns of changes in social isolation and dementia and the interrelations between these developmental trajectories. The study sample included 7,609 Medicare beneficiaries age 65 and older from the National Health and Aging Trends Study 2011 through 2018 surveys. A group-based dual trajectory modeling approach was used to identify distinct groups of developmental trajectories for social isolation and dementia status over the 8-year period. The dual model provided estimates of conditional and joint probabilities linking the two sets of trajectory groups. Changes in social isolation over an 8-year period followed four trajectories: rarely isolated (62.2%), steady increase (13.5%), steady decrease (7.4%), and persistently isolated (16.9%). Changes in dementia risk also followed four trajectories: persistently low risk (80.4%), increasing with early onset (3.9%), increasing with late onset (4.5%), and persistently high risk (11.2%). Over two-third (68%) of the persistently low dementia group were also in the rarely isolated group. Both increasing dementia groups were composed mainly of individuals from the increasing social isolation group (40-43%) and persistently isolated group (24-29%). The persistently high dementia group had the most overlap with the decreasing social isolation group (47%), followed by the persistently isolated group (28%). For the most part, social isolation and dementia evolve in the same direction for older adults over an 8-year period. However, the pattern of associations between these developmental trajectories is complex and may be reversed among long-term dementia survivors.

Main funding source(s): Medical University of Bialystok, Poland Background Cardiovascular disease (CVD) is a major, worldwide problem and remain the dominant cause of premature mortality in the word. Simultaneously the metabolic syndrome is a growing problem. The aim of this study was to investigate the cardiometabolic profile among cardiovascular risk classes, and to estimate CV risk using various calculators. Methods The longitudinal, population-based study, was conducted in 2017-2020. A total of 931 individuals aged 20-79 were included. Anthropometric and biochemical profiles were measured according to a standardized protocols. The study population was divided into CV risk classes according to the latest recommendation. Comparisons variables between subgroups were conducted using Dwass-Steele-Critchlow-Fligner test. To estimate CV risk were used: the  Systematic Coronary Risk Estimation system, Framingham Risk Score and LIFEtime-perspective model for individualizing CardioVascular Disease prevention strategies in apparently healthy people (LIFE-CVD). Results The mean age was 49.1± 15.5 years, 43.2% were male. Percentages of low-risk, moderate-risk, high-risk and very-high CV risk were 46.1%, 22.8%, 13.5%, 17.6%, respectively. Most of the analyzed anthropometric, body composition and laboratory parameters did not differ between the moderate and high CV risk participants, whereas the low risk group differed significantly. In the moderate and high-risk groups, abdominal distribution of adipose tissue dominated with significantly elevated parameters of insulin resistance. Interestingly, estimating lifetime risk of myocardial infarction, stroke or CV death using LIFE-CVD calculator yielded similar results in moderate and high CV risk classes. Conclusion The participants belonging to moderate and high CV risk classes have a very similar unfavorable cardiometabolic profile which may result in the similar lifetime CV risk. This may imply the need for more aggressive pharmacological and non-pharmacological management of CV risk factors in the moderate CV risk population. It would be advisable to consider combining the moderate and high risk classes into one high CV risk class, or it may be worth adding one of the parameters of abdominal fat distribution to the CV risk calculators as an expression of increased insulin resistance. BACKGROUND Technology has become the most critical approach to maintain social connectedness during the COVID-19 pandemic. Older adults (over age 65) are perceived as most physiologically vulnerable to COVID-19 and at risk of secondary mental health challenges related to social isolation imposed by virus containment strategies. To mitigate concerns regarding sampling bias we used a random sampling of older adults to understand uptake and acceptance of technologies to support socialization during the pandemic. OBJECTIVE To conduct a random population-based assessment of the barriers and facilitators to engaging in technology use for virtual socialization amongst older adults in the Canadian province of British Columbia during the COVID-19 pandemic. METHODS We conducted a cross-sectional population-based survey using random-digit dialing to participants over age 65 living in British Columbia. Data were analyzed using SPSS, with open-text responses analyzed using thematic analysis. RESULTS Respondents included 400 older adults with an average age of 72 years old and 63.7% female. Most respondents (89.5%) were aware of how to use technology to connect with others and slightly more than half (56%) reported using technology differently to connect with others during the pandemic. 55.9% of respondents reported adopting new technology since the beginning of the pandemic. Older adults reported key barriers to using technology including: (1) lack of access (including finance, knowledge, and age); (2) lack of interest (including a preference for telephone, and a general lack of interest in computers); and (3) physical barriers (resultant of cognitive impairments, stroke, and arthritis). Older adults reported numerous facilitators, including: (1) knowledge of technologies (whether self-taught or via external courses); (2) reliance on others (family, friends, and general internet searching); (3) technology accessibility (including environments, user-friendly technology, and receiving clear instructions); and (4) social motivation (because everyone else is doing it). CONCLUSIONS Much data on older adults use of technology is limited by sampling biases, but the current study that used random sampling demonstrated that older adults used technology to mitigate social isolation during the pandemic. Virtual socialization is most promising to mitigate potential mental health effects related to virus containment strategies. Addressing barriers by mobilizing telephone training and task lists, and mobilizing facilitators described by participants such as facilitated socialization activities are important strategies that can be implemented within and beyond the pandemic to bolster the mental health needs of older adults.

Background and Purpose— ABCD 2 score has been developed to predict the early risk of stroke after transient ischemic attack (TIA). The aim of this study was to clarify whether ABCD 2 score predicts the occurrence of stroke in the long term after TIA. Methods— Fukuoka Stroke Registry (FSR) is a multicenter epidemiological study database on acute stoke. From June 2007 to June 2011, 496 (305 males, 70 ± 13 years of age) patients who had suffered from TIA and were hospitalized in the 7 stroke centers within 7 days after the onset of TIA were enrolled in this study. The patients were divided into three groups according to the risk: low-risk (ABCD 2 score 0-3; n=72), moderate-risk (4-5; n=229) and high-risk group (6-7; n=195). They were followed up prospectively for up to 3 years. Cox proportional hazard regression model was used to elucidate whether ABCD 2 score was a predictor for stroke after TIA after adjusting for confounding factors. Results— Among three groups, there were significant differences in age, hypertension, diabetes mellitus and the decrease in estimated glomerular filtration rate (P<0.01, significantly). During a mean follow-up of 1.3 years, Kaplan-Meier analysis demonstrated that the stroke rate in TIA patients was significantly lower in low-risk group than in moderate-risk or high-risk group (log rank test, p<0.001). The adjusted hazard ratios for stroke in patients with TIA increased with moderate-risk group (Hazard ratio [HR]: 3.47, 95% CI: 1.03-21.66, P<0.05) and high-risk group (HR: 4.46, 95% CI: 1.31-27.85, P<0.05), compared to low-risk group. Conclusions— The ABCD 2 score is able to predict the long-term risk of stroke after TIA.

Background: Older adults with diabetes are less likely to benefit and more likely to be harmed by intensive glucose control. Prior research has shown that many older adults continue to be intensively managed despite guidelines that recommend that treatment targets should be relaxed in these patients. As many new agents have been introduced with minimal risk of hypoglycemia, we examined contemporary data to understand to what extent older patients with diabetes are still intensively managed with agents that can cause hypoglycemia. Methods: We examined A1c and treatment data in adults ≥75 years with type 2 diabetes from 151 US outpatient sites in DCR. Patients were categorized as poor control (A1c >9%), moderate control (A1c >8-9%), conservative control (A1c 7-8%), tight control/low-risk agents (A1c <7% on meds with low risk for hypoglycemia), and tight control/high-risk agents (A1c <7% on insulin, sulfonylureas, or meglitinides). Adults with A1c <7% on no glucose-lowering medications were excluded. We used hierarchical logistic regression to examine patient and site factors associated with tight control/high-risk agents vs. conservative control or tight control/low-risk agents. Results: Among 30,696 older adults with diabetes, 5,596 (18%) had moderate or poor control, 9,227 (30%) conservative control, 7,893 (26%) tight control/low-risk agents, and 7,980 (26%) tight control/high-risk agents (Fig. A). Older age, male sex, heart failure, chronic kidney disease, and coronary artery disease were each independently associated with a greater odds of tight control/high-risk agents (Fig. B). After adjusting for patient factors, there were no differences among practice specialties (endocrinology, primary care, cardiology) in how aggressively patients were managed. Conclusion: Despite greater availability of agents that do not cause hypoglycemia, a quarter of older adults with type 2 diabetes are tightly controlled with high-risk medications. These results suggest potential overtreatment of a substantial proportion of patients. Efforts are needed to provide more specific guidance on how to safely treat older adults with diabetes (both through targeting treatment with low-risk agents and through de-escalation of glucose control) and then to efficiently translate that guidance into busy clinical practice.

Abstract Background Hypertension (HTN) and coronary artery disease (CAD) are a prevalent combination in women, however limited data are available to guide blood pressure (BP) management. We hypothesize older women with HTN and CAD may not derive the same prognostic benefit from systolic BP (SBP) lowering <130 mmHg. Purpose To investigate the long-term mortality implications of different achieved SBP levels in hypertensive women with CAD. Methods Long-term, all-cause mortality data were analyzed for 9216 women, stratified by risk attributable to clinical severity of CAD (women with prior myocardial infarction or revascularization considered at high, all others at low risk) and by age (50 - <65 or ≥65 yo). The prognostic impact of achieving mean in-trial SBP <130 (referent group) was compared with 130 to <140 and ≥140 mmHg using Cox proportional hazards, adjusting for demographic and clinical characteristics. Results During 108,838 person-years of follow-up, 2945 deaths occurred. High risk women (n=3011) had increased long-term mortality in comparison to low risk women (n=6205) (adjusted HR 1.38, CI 1.28–1.5, p<0.001). Within risk groups, crude mortality percentages decreased according to BP values (table). As expected, high risk women were more likely to be ≥65 yo (68.68% vs. 50.51%, p<0.0001) or have SBP ≥140 mmHg (43.08% vs. 31.18%, p<0.0001). In adjusted analyses, an SBP ≥140 mmHg was associated with worse outcomes than SBP <130 mmHg in the entire cohort (HR 1.3, CI 1.2–1.5, p<0.0001) and when stratifying by risk (low risk group, HR = 1.47, CI 1.28–1.7, p<0.0001; high risk group, HR = 1.71, CI 1.01–1.35, p=0.03). In analyses stratified by age and risk, women ≥65 years and at high risk had decreased mortality in the 130 - <140 SBP category vs. <130 mmHg (HR 0.812, 95% CI 0.689–0.957, p=0.0133; figure). Women and deaths by risk and SBP group Group SBP category Women (n) Mortality (n) Mortality (%) High risk <130 773 338 44 130–<140 941 414 44 ≥140 1297 694 54 Low risk <130 2187 390 18 130–<140 2083 451 22 ≥140 1935 658 34 SBP = systolic blood pressure; n = number; % = percent per each group. Mortality adjusted HRs Conclusion In women ≥65 yo with hypertension and prior myocardial infarction and/or coronary revascularization enrolled in INVEST, a SBP between 130 to <140 mmHg was associated with lower all-cause, long-term mortality versus SBP <130 mmHg. Abstract Evidence continues to mount that sleep apnea (SA) occurs in 10-25% of Americans and is associated with significant morbidity and mortality (Schulman 2018). Among veterans, SA has been reported four times more often as compared to other non-veteran cohorts. (Wong 2015). The risk of developing dementia is increased in older individuals with OSA (Shastri, Bangar, & Holmes, 2015). The prevalence and characteristics of older adults with dementia and sleep apnea is not well known and long-term population-based studies on mortality have been lacking. Recent studies have reported overall mortality rates of 19%, in those individuals with SA, an increased rate of 1.5-3 times the mortality rate as compared to those individuals those without SA. Current recommendations support SA screening of high risk individuals including those with symptoms of snoring, fatigue, memory and concentration problems and mood changes. (Krist 2018). Despite a large number of older adults with suspected SA and comorbidities, the majority are not screened, referred, diagnosed and treated. In this VA pilot study of outpatient older male veterans with dementia and SA, N=195, mean age 75.83 years, SD=9.1, 51.3% were white, 37.5% were black. Frequently found comorbidities were: hypertension 88%, congestive heart failure 41%, Diabetes. 62% and, stroke 21%. Of note, among those who died, SA was significantly related to congested heart failure (r=.32, p&lt;.001) and COPD (r=.40, p&lt;.001). The overall mortality rate of 27% was higher than previous reports. Further investigation is needed to better understand the relationship between comorbidities, and SA, screening, treatment and mortality.
